Description

NoxCam-Pola is part of the NoxCam series, sharing the same powerful NoxEngine sensor management, image processing and embedded recording as for all cameras in the serie.

NoxCam-Pola embeds a cooled polarimetric longwave infrared sensor, delivering within a single image, polarimetric information in four directions together with a crisp infrared image. With its high separation power between polarization direction, it provides real time, isochronous information never captured before.

Polarimetric information in known to bring advantages in applications such as Oil spill detection, Biometric security as well as NDT applications. NoxCam-Pola brings you the ideal tool for your lab and field evaluations.

Equipped with the first of its kind pixel-level polarimetric infrared detector, cooled by stirling engine, NoxCam Pola camera offers unmatched performance and flexibility in a reduced footprint, together with ease of use provided by on-board raw calibrated data recording, embedded control software and compatibility with industry standard analysis software such as Matlab® or ImageJ.

Technical Information

NoxCam-Pola standard sensing configurations

 

Detector Type:Cooled, snapshot FPA
Spectral Band:LWIR Band – 7μm to 10μm
Integrated Optical Filter Wheel
Image Size: 640×512 – 15μm pitch or 320×256 – 30µm pitch
Polarisation sensing:Pixel-level 2×2 structure
with distinct polarization (0°, 45°, 90°, -45°) angles
Frame Rate:Up to 60Hz
Optical Aperture:f/2
Lenses Range:From 12mm to 200mm
Microscopic lens

Features

Radiometric measurement

Measurement Range

Typical 5°C to 300°C, Radiometric measurement ranges are optimized to fit your application requirements and can be set between sub-zero to up to 3000°C. A Radiometric measurement evaluation is performed for each user case. Noxant’s Radiometric Measurements are compensated against temperature deviation.

NETD

Typical 20mK, it is indicative only as NETD value deviation is wide up on measurement conditions. NETD can be dramatically improved using the NoxCam HSi Synchronous Lock-in input.

Sync Input

Ultra low jitter input signal allows to synchronize the photon collection time with an external event, such as PLC signal, a rotation coder or a photoelectric cell.

Lens interface

Although we offer a wide range of lenses, we recognize that users may already own existing valuable lenses. We promote reusing them. To do so, NoxCam HSi can be fitted with Industry standard bayonet interface or a M80 interface. It is also possible to fit it with a custom interface on demand.

Data and control interfaces

Interface

  • GigEVision / Genicam
  • Optional Camera Link base or medium

Recording Format

  • Radiometric RAW or h.264

Recording Media

  • Removable 2,5″ SSD

Video output format

  • Color HDMI 720p with color overlay
  • Optional SDI

Software compatibility

Flexibility is important to us. NoxCam cameras are compatible with all major operating systems such as Windows®, Mac OS X® or Linux®. Recorded RAW sequences are compatible with industry standard analysis software such as ImageJ, Matlab® orLabview®. File formats, radiometric calibration data and procedures are provided to our customer on demand.
